Team Leader

Cornell Cooperative Extension of Chautauqua County has an opening for a Team Lead working on-site from the Jamestown office. CCE is seeking a dynamic leader to assist with daily functioning of the Association, responsible for providing leadership in assessment, development, planning, delivery and evaluation of agriculture educational programming. The Team Leader will also assist in the Executive Director’s absence to plan for the overall administration of the Association and provide continuity of leadership. A master’s degree with a minimum of 2 years’ related experience is required for this full-time position. The salary range is $63,000 - $65,000 based on knowledge, skills, experience, and abilities.
